You know, that Blade Runner cover reminds me of this movie I picked up on betamax a while back.
The actual title of the movie was Truckin' Buddy McCoy, a rather bland trucker movie largely devoid of any action or chase scenes, but the local distributor decided to market it under the title "Convoy 3" as if it were a sequel to the Sam Peckinpah movie - and to do that, they not only retitled the movie, but they also recycled the poster art for the actual Convoy movie, slapping "3" at the end of the title - but only once I got the tape in my hands, I noticed they'd also crudely scribbled over the features of Kris Kristofferson and Ali MacGraw, resulting in neither looking quite like themselves while also still not looking like anybody who actually appears in the movie!
That combined with the blatantly misleading description of the premise on the back of the box has lead me to dub the sleeve as "video cover of lies" where you can't even trust the rating.
